


Marina di Capitana
Marina di Capitana stretches for nearly a kilometer along the Sardinian coastline, about 26 km south of Cagliari in the quiet semi-urban fringe of Quartu Sant'Elena. The sea here is generally calm and sheltered, making it a relaxed base if you're coming or going from Cagliari — reachable in about 25 minutes by taxi or 50 minutes by bus. It's low-key and unhurried, with waterfront facilities including mooring with services, and max draft info available directly through the marina.
